Nearby locations
Elm Hill, Connecticut, United States
Newington, Connecticut, United States
Griswoldville, Connecticut, United States
Nearby popular places
Twenty Rod Road Park, United States
Candlewyck Park, United States
Vexation Hill, United States

Weather Radar in Twenty Rod Road Park, United States

View entire country on Radar
The Tomorrow.io Platform
To view the map, please use a browser that supports WebGL.